Poorly understood and articulated requirements have been widely acknowledged as the main contributor for software development problems. A number of studies suggest that a holistic understanding of the concerns (goals and issues) surrounding software development and stakeholders' active participation are two critical factors for the success of requirements engineering. The research as documented in this thesis thus aims to solve the problem by developing and demonstrating a new approach necessary for eliciting, analyzing, and specifying various stakeholders' concerns. The aim has been achieved with the development and demonstration of the Concern-Aware Requirements Engineering (CARE) method. The CARE method was developed by combining goal-or...
This new edition describes current best practices in requirements engineering with a focus primarily...
There is a significant change in how we collect software requirements nowadays. The two main reasons...
Software engineering practices are becoming increasingly important in order to mitigate any risk of ...
Requirements engineering (RE) is concerned with the identification of the goals to be achieved by th...
Requirements engineering (RE) is concerned with the elicitation of the objectives to be achieved by ...
Part 1: Cross-Domain Conference and Workshop on Multidisciplinary Research and Practice for Informat...
The Requirement Engineering (RE) is a systemic and integrated process of eliciting, elaborating, neg...
Requirements engineering is concerned with the elicitation of high-level goals to be achieved by the...
Software and System Requirements Engineering (RE) is considered a critical process for successful pr...
The establishment of smart environments, Internet of Things (IoT) and socio-technical systems has in...
Abstract. [Context and motivation] During requirements engineering the stakeholder view is typically...
Requirements specification has long been recognized as a critical activity in software development p...
Requirements Engineering (RE) is concerned with the elicitation, evaluation, specification, analysis...
Abstract. The goals of developing systems better, faster, and cheaper continue to drive software eng...
Many methodologies have been proposed to systematize the software development process. Many of them ...
This new edition describes current best practices in requirements engineering with a focus primarily...
There is a significant change in how we collect software requirements nowadays. The two main reasons...
Software engineering practices are becoming increasingly important in order to mitigate any risk of ...
Requirements engineering (RE) is concerned with the identification of the goals to be achieved by th...
Requirements engineering (RE) is concerned with the elicitation of the objectives to be achieved by ...
Part 1: Cross-Domain Conference and Workshop on Multidisciplinary Research and Practice for Informat...
The Requirement Engineering (RE) is a systemic and integrated process of eliciting, elaborating, neg...
Requirements engineering is concerned with the elicitation of high-level goals to be achieved by the...
Software and System Requirements Engineering (RE) is considered a critical process for successful pr...
The establishment of smart environments, Internet of Things (IoT) and socio-technical systems has in...
Abstract. [Context and motivation] During requirements engineering the stakeholder view is typically...
Requirements specification has long been recognized as a critical activity in software development p...
Requirements Engineering (RE) is concerned with the elicitation, evaluation, specification, analysis...
Abstract. The goals of developing systems better, faster, and cheaper continue to drive software eng...
Many methodologies have been proposed to systematize the software development process. Many of them ...
This new edition describes current best practices in requirements engineering with a focus primarily...
There is a significant change in how we collect software requirements nowadays. The two main reasons...
Software engineering practices are becoming increasingly important in order to mitigate any risk of ...